For schools, churches, and smaller neighborhood parks needing commercial playground equipment without dedicating space to a massive structure, the Coastal Citadel Castle Spark Playground Structure delivers a strong mix of adventure play and compact efficiency. Its castle-inspired design naturally draws children in while keeping circulation manageable for tighter playground layouts.
The Coastal Citadel Castle Spark Playground Structure offers multiple ways to engage different skill levels. Younger children or those needing easier access can use the Transfer Station stairs, while more confident climbers often gravitate toward the Drawbridge Climber for a more active route to the upper deck. This combination supports balance, coordination, and confidence-building without overwhelming younger users.
Up top, children can move between the Plinko Panel and Ball Maze Panel, encouraging problem-solving, hand-eye coordination, and cooperative play. Two slide experiences add variety without increasing the structure’s footprint.
The Bench Panel creates a practical resting point that helps extend play sessions and gives caregivers better visibility during busy recess periods. In school playground settings, compact structures like the Coastal Citadel often work well when paired with independent play events or shaded seating nearby to improve traffic flow and supervision.
Designed for active daily use, this school playground structure can support installations following ASTM and CPSC playground safety guidelines, helping provide safer climbing transitions, age-appropriate play challenges, and dependable layout planning. It also pairs well with ADA accessible playground surfacing to improve inclusive access around the play area.
